Owl City: Happy Hooter Feels at Home Walking Around Apartment

Owls live almost everywhere, including deserts, steppes, mountains, sea coasts and forest zones. Now that so many animals are making urban inroads due to this year's lockdowns, is it any surprise that this nocturnal bird has made its nest in an apartment?

The size of an own depends on the species; the smallest weigh no more than 80 grams, while the largest weigh up to four kilograms.

This owl was spotted burrowing in a residential flat with his white friend, perhaps having taken to heart the "stay at home" messages that have been broadcast around the world amid national lockdowns and quarantines launched in response to the coronavirus.
